33 As I live”—the declaration of the Lord God—“I will rule over you with a strong hand, an outstretched arm,(A) and outpoured wrath. 34 I will bring you from the peoples and gather you from the countries where you were scattered,(B) with a strong hand, an outstretched arm,(C) and outpoured wrath. 35 I will lead you into the wilderness of the peoples(D) and enter into judgment with you there face to face. 36 Just as I entered into judgment with your fathers in the wilderness of the land of Egypt,(E) so I will enter into judgment with you.” This is the declaration of the Lord God. 37 “I will make you pass under the rod(F) and will bring you into the bond of the covenant. 38 And I will also purge you of those who rebel and transgress against Me.(G) I will bring them out of the land where they live as foreign residents, but they will not enter the land of Israel. Then you will know that I am Yahweh.

39 “As for you, house of Israel, this is what the Lord God says: Go and serve your idols, each of you. But afterward you will surely listen to Me, and you will no longer defile My holy name with your gifts and idols.(H)

33 As surely as I live, says the Sovereign Lord, I will rule over you with an iron fist in great anger and with awesome power. 34 And in anger I will reach out with my strong hand and powerful arm, and I will bring you back[a] from the lands where you are scattered. 35 I will bring you into the wilderness of the nations, and there I will judge you face to face. 36 I will judge you there just as I did your ancestors in the wilderness after bringing them out of Egypt, says the Sovereign Lord. 37 I will examine you carefully and hold you to the terms of the covenant. 38 I will purge you of all those who rebel and revolt against me. I will bring them out of the countries where they are in exile, but they will never enter the land of Israel. Then you will know that I am the Lord.

39 “As for you, O people of Israel, this is what the Sovereign Lord says: Go right ahead and worship your idols, but sooner or later you will obey me and will stop bringing shame on my holy name by worshiping idols.
